Gameplay Mechanics
Now, let's talk about the gameplay. Mini Golf Club-PvP Multiplayer offers both single-player and multiplayer modes. This is where it gets interesting. You can challenge your friends or random players across the globe, which adds a nice competitive edge. I had a blast playing against my buddy who lives across the country. It’s like we were right there on the course together.
The controls are intuitive. You drag to aim and release to shoot. Simple, right? But don’t let that fool you; the courses are designed to test your skills. There are crazy obstacles, tricky slopes, and jumps that require precision. It’s not just about power; it’s about finesse.
Features to Look Out For
One of my favorite features is the variety of courses. There are over 50 creative and challenging courses, each with its own unique theme and obstacles. From pirate ships to desert landscapes, you’re taken on a mini-vacation with each level.
Plus, the game updates frequently with new courses and features, which keeps things fresh. There's also a leaderboard, so if you’re the competitive type, you’ll find yourself coming back to improve your rank.
